But that's not FreeBSD. That's Unix. And all unix[like] including all Linux, are the same in that point. You only may get a different impression, when you pick some turn-key OS that autoinstalls a DE.

On Unix the main UI is the terminal, the shell. Anything else is optional.

FreeBSD is a multipurpose OS, which means, it tries to serve different kinds of computers and purposes. While a single user desktop computer with a DE is just one possible purpose. To respect different kinds of purposes, it comes only with what's needed for all purposes, and the ability to easily add all the optional packages needed to fulfill a certain purpose.
A turn-key OS, like many Linux distros also like some BSD derivates, does it otherwise. It serves a single purpose, only: A single-user desktop on a x86-machine, fully autoinstalling with a GUI.
This may suggests, the TUI (terminal) was optional, but in fact it's not. It's still the same principal: The terminal is the core main UI in all unix[like], and a GUI is an extra toppiece placed upon it. It's just the user is passed by most of the shell stuff and set infront of a GUI directly. There is no GUI-only OS. Windows tried, but failed, because there are always things sooner or later you need some kind of a CLI for. And better a real shell in the first place, than that thing what Windows provides.
But FreeBSD does it not much otherwise. The only difference is, you need an extra step each to get a machine for a certain purpose, like a single-user desktop. If you wanna GUI, tell it to install X.org. Then it detects the hardware, installs the right drivers, and X.org. If you are not satisfied with twm, which comes with X.Org, but want another WM or even DE, tell it which one to install, and it installs it for you. Then pick the software packages you want to have, and tell it to install them.
No rocketscience, just a couple of more steps, that's all.

Serving one purpose only is the requirement for fully automating the installation process - to spare the user the strenuous effort of deciding which software to use, pick and install it by himself.
The price you pay for that, apart from getting a single-user desktop machine, only, is you don't get your individually tailored machine. You get a pre-picked and preset DE, everything already designed in advance, pre-picked software packages, pre-configured look-and-feel, etc. For that, you also have to compromise even more: If you wanna use a certain distro, you have to live with the DE it comes with. Or you want a certain DE, you can only pick from the few systems that delivers that. You have to live what others picked. If that's okay for you, and for the most it is, then it's fine. Problem solved. But if not, e.g. you try to use another DE/WM instead of the default one, in most cases the tinkering starts, real tinkering. Because your are going to mess with a system that's not intended for this. At the latest you run into lots of trouble, when there is an update. Because many turn-key OSs are not capable to deal with their users modifying core fundamentals about it by themselves. That contradicts the core idea of a turn-key OS.

The point ain't compilation time. The point is, if the compilation runs abortion-less through, or need additional tinkering. When FreeBSD version and the port tree are congruent, matching, then all port's compilations run through. And that's exactly one of the essential core ideas of FreeBSD: To provide a congruent, matching set of system and ports. That's what you get, when you use RELEASE.
But you don't have to compile anything at all. Just stick to packages. When you don't do no modifications but simply compile the default you get the same result as with the packages anyway. So compilation is only needed when you modify something with a package, or for a very few exceptions (see the forums). But they are not the default, and anyway no big deal at all whatsover. Just do make install clean BATCH=yes (maybe without the 'clean') and just let it run! If your versions match, it will run through, and being installed - everything fully automated working.

Don't become panicky by all the troubles you read here. Trust the Handbook. Apart from some people here doing special things, sometimes even real freaky stuff, there is lots of experimenting with development versions et al going on.
Most of the issues posted here are caused by simply just don't read the Handbook, or failed experiments, fumbling, tinkering with CURRENT instead of just using RELEASE, mixing ports and packages of different versions, getting sources from elsewhere than just simply using the ports, or doing some things they got by some AI chatbot, not knowing shit what exactly they are doing... fatfingering causes troubles, of course.
Just read and stick to the Handbook, and FreeBSD runs fine.

My tip was:
Do a clean, new installation of a RELEASE, then just do what's in the Handbook, only:
pkg install drm-kmod for Intel and AMD GPU, or
pkg install nvidia-drm-kmod for NVIDIA
pkg install xorg
add your user to the video group, so not only root is allowed to have access to that resource
pkg install xfce xfce-4.20_2 Meta-port for the Xfce Desktop Environment
And for the rest, like get your user have access to USB flashdrives, also stick to the Handbook.

I bet you have a up and running XFCE on FreeBSD within less than 2 hours, and no tinkering.
